Answer:

Q1

<u>The exponential growth model for frogs:</u>

  • F(x) = 100(1.22)ˣ,

F- number of frogs, x- number of years, 1.22 - growth factor

<u>Calculations</u>:

  • F(5) = 100(1.22)⁵ = 270
  • a) F(10) = 100(1.22)¹⁰ = 730
  • b) F(20) = 100(1.22)²⁰ = 5335  

<em>All numbers rounded </em>

Q2

<u>The exponential growth model for bacteria:</u>

  • B(x) = 10(1.8)ˣ

B- number of bacteria, x- number of hours, 1.8 - growth factor

<u>Calculations:</u>

  • a) B(5) = 10(1.8)⁵ = 189
  • b) B(24) = 10(1.8)²⁴ = 13382588
  • c) B(168) = 10(1.8)¹⁶⁸ = 7.68 * 10⁴³

<em>All numbers rounded </em>

Q3.

<u>The exponential growth model for fish:</u>

  • F(x) = 821(1.02)ˣ,

F- number of fish, x- number of months, 1.02 - growth factor

<u>Calculations:</u>

  • a) F(12) = 821(1.02)¹² = 1041
  • b) F(120) = 821(1.02)¹²⁰ = 8838

<em>All numbers rounded </em>

Y=3x+18 <br> -12x+4y=-24 linear system of equations
solong [7]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Use substitution, y=3x+18 so -12x+4(3x+18)=-24. From here you can try to solve for x

-12x+12x+72=-24

The xs cancel, which leaves you with 72=-24

Since 72 cannot equal -24 there is no answer to this system of equations

Can some explain how to do this.
KatRina [158]

We can simplify the expression by using exponent properties, and we will see that the correct option is the fourth option.

<h3>How to simplify the expression?</h3>

Remember the exponent property:

\frac{a^n}{a^m} = a^{n - m}

Here we have the expression:

\frac{83.9*10^{12}*2.87*10^{-3}}{3.76*10^2}

We can reorder this to get:

\frac{83.9*10^{12}*2.87*10^{-3}}{3.76*10^2} = \frac{83.9*2.87}{3.76}*\frac{10^{12}*10^{-3}}{10^2}

The right side can be simplified to:

\frac{83.9*2.87}{3.76}*\frac{10^{12}*10^{-3}}{10^2} = 64.04*10{12 - 3 - 2} = 64.04*10^{7}

Now, we can move the decimal point one time to the left and increase the exponent by one, so we get:

6.404*10^8

Then we conclude that the correct option is the last one (where I rounded the expression to only 3 values after the decimal point).
